The e-cig industry is full of sharks. Big, fat sharks that swim the seas convincing people their products are 'the best' or 'No.1 rated' or a load of other things.
DO NOT BUY from these companies. They use fake reviews, fake comparison websites, and re-brand existing products to then charge you an excessive price.
I cannot name the evil people behind all this, but some of them are even revered within the industry as 'influential people'.... I'm afraid it's a massive con.
Most of us on here use products made by;
Joyetech Kanger Innokin
Sigelei Aspire ELeaf
IPV (Pioneer 4 U) Smok and others.
and there are more less mainstream products made by companies like
Provape (very high quality)
Vaporshark (higher quality/innovative)
If the shop you are considering using to buy your hardware appears to sell none of these manufacturers, there is a very high chance it is a 'Brand' e-cig where everything is made by the people above except you have the pleasure of paying up to 4 times as much.

Novices sometimes balk at the price it costs to start vaping. I say determine how much you spent per month on cigarettes. At $5 - $10 a pack, a pack-a-day smoker spends $150 to $300 a month to smoke. With that budget in mind, you should be able to find a reasonably priced setup for $100 or less. Then consider that once you have your gear or hardware, your subsequent costs per month will be only for replacement coils for your tanks and e-liquid (about $60 - $70 a month).
